Types of Entrepreneurship Certificate Programs

Entrepreneurship certificate programs offer diverse learning pathways tailored to different career goals, schedules, and learning preferences. These programs divide into three main categories, each providing unique advantages for aspiring entrepreneurs.

University-Based Certificates

Academic institutions deliver comprehensive entrepreneurship certificates through their business schools or continuing education departments. These programs integrate traditional classroom instruction with experiential learning opportunities in 4-8 month formats. Students access university resources including research facilities, innovation labs, and business incubators. The curriculum covers advanced topics like venture capital funding, intellectual property rights, and strategic business growth. Leading programs from institutions like MIT, Stanford, and Harvard maintain direct connections with successful entrepreneurs who serve as guest speakers and mentors.

Online Learning Platforms

Digital education providers offer flexible entrepreneurship certificates through platforms like Coursera, Udacity, and edX. Students complete self-paced modules covering business fundamentals, market analysis, and digital marketing strategies. These programs feature interactive elements including virtual simulations, peer discussions, and automated assessments. Course content updates regularly to reflect current market trends and technological innovations. Students receive personalized feedback through AI-powered tools and participate in virtual networking events with industry professionals.

Professional Organizations

Industry associations provide specialized entrepreneurship certificates focused on practical applications. Organizations like the International Council for Small Business and the National Association for the Self-Employed offer targeted programs lasting 3-6 months. These certificates emphasize real-world skills through case studies, mentorship programs, and business plan competitions. Members gain access to exclusive resources including market research databases, legal document templates, and funding opportunities. The certification process includes hands-on projects evaluated by experienced entrepreneurs and industry experts.

Cost and Time Investment

Entrepreneurship certificate programs range from $1,500 to $15,000, varying based on the institution type, program duration and curriculum depth. University-based programs typically cost $8,000 to $15,000, including access to research facilities, faculty expertise and networking events. Online certification platforms offer more affordable options between $1,500 to $4,000, featuring self-paced learning modules and digital resources.
